99: Chapter 23 Parable of the Garden_1 99: Chapter 23 Parable of the Garden_1 If the First University was really a living entity, it would undoubtedly have symptoms of schizophrenia.

Zheng Qing had no doubt about this.

Since interacting with the interviewers of the First University, right through to everything he saw and heard at the Four Seasons Pavilion and his actual enrollment in the university, Zheng Qing had encountered numerous contradictions and disagreements.

For example, the university had four ways to admit students!

As a Jiuyou person who had gotten into the university through exams, Zheng Qing could not comprehend the other admission methods.

Maybe talent selection, faith identification, or combat power evaluation had some rationality, but in Zheng Qing’s view, these methods of admitting new students lacked the basic element of fairness.

The most direct consequence of this unfairness was the disparity in campus culture.

The disparities were so pronounced that communication between students from different colleges was like conversation between strangers.

If it weren’t for schizophrenia, how could the First University allow different thoughts to coexist within itself?

However, compared to worrying about the fairness of the university’s education, Zheng Qing was more concerned about his own studies.

Lacking the foundation of secondary education, he was now facing the challenge of higher education.

This impact was unsettling.

Whether it was the exams that the interviewers emphasized repeatedly, or the repeaters they mentioned inadvertently, both left deep shadows in the hearts of terrified freshmen.

What if the exams go badly?

Would he be sent back!

What if he fails the promotion exam?

Will he repeat a year!

Isn’t repeating the year very humiliating!

Would he be pointed and gossiped about by others!

The mock exams a few days ago did not alleviate his worries but instead intensified his uneasiness.

Because the master always warned him that the higher one floats, the harder one falls, it is important to know oneself.

Now, his classmates told him that Alpha Academy does not need exams and there was no risk of repeating any year!

Compared to the strict Jiuyou, this enviable learning environment is incredibly beneficial.

“Same school, different rewards,” Zheng Qing muttered, looking at Lin Guo with envy, “When can Jiuyou abolish the examination policy.”

“Without exams, there wouldn’t be a Jiuyou Academy,” Xiao Xiao sharply retorted, “Besides, the rules of Alpha Academy are not as relaxed as you think.”

“I know that.” Zhang Ji Xin waved his fist from the side and added, “My brother told me that the graduation rate of Alpha Academy is less than sixty percent every year!

In the academy now, there are still a lot of veterans struggling to finish their graduation thesis.

In comparison, the graduation rate of Jiuyou Academy is over ninety percent!”

“Indeed.” Lin Guo looked sincerely at Zheng Qing and rubbed his nose, “Every academy has to maintain the honor of First University.

Alpha Academy typically has a more liberal entry with strict conditions for exit.”

“Regardless, your learning environment is very free.” Zheng Qing sighed.

Xiao Xiao issued a sharp, brief laugh.

Zheng Qing shot him an angry look.

“No one tells you what classes you should take, no one tells you whether your choice is wrong.” Xiao Xiao sarcastically added, “Yes, there/was/always/a/choice.

Yes, you/always/have/a/choice.

Throwing the right to choose to the individual, glorifying it as ‘freedom’.

Little did they know, this is the greatest irresponsibility towards the individual.

Not everyone could access effective information or have the ability to choose correctly for themselves.”

“This sentence is a bit confusing.” Zhang Ji Xin looked a little puzzled.

“Let me give you an example.

Let’s take two boys.

One boy’s parents are both registered wizards and the other’s parents are commoners.

The parents who are registered wizards can plan for their son’s career progression from a very young age, while the commoner’s parents know nothing about it.”

Xiao Xiao held his notebook and continued to refine his example:

“When the two boys both entered Alpha Academy, the boy whose parents are registered wizards could choose the courses necessary for his major with a clear goal; while the boy with commoner parents would be hitting hammers everywhere, as if he had learned many courses, but none of these were helpful for advancing to a registered wizard.”

“Can we deny that both boys always had the right to choose?” Xiao Xiao waved his notebook with a mocking face, “It’s just that one is choosing the right path with his eyes wide open; the other is closing his eyes and hitting a dead mouse with his blind cat feeling.”

“Looking at it this way, Alpha’s educational method is indeed unfair.” Zheng Qing stroked his chin and nodded thoughtfully.

“This has always been the opinion of Jiuyou Academy, but justice is about letting everyone get what they deserve.” Lin Guo stubbornly defended the honor of his own academy, “The boy whose parents are registered wizards could certainly become a registered wizard; but the boy whose parents are commoners will eventually find his true talents.

I remember one professor who made an extremely appropriate analogy for the views of the two schools.”

“The Garden Metaphor?” Xiao Xiao raised his eyelids and glanced at the boy.

“Yes.

The garden contains many varieties of flourishing plants.

The owner of the garden can choose to continuously trim crooked branches, remove rotten leaves, and make the entire garden neat and beautiful.

The owner can also choose to let the plants grow freely, wantonly displaying the beauty and harmony of nature.”

Lin Guo’s face turned red with excitement while defensively adding:

“Does the poplar want to grow tall?

It’s okay, just strive to grow upward!

Does the ivy want to find a place to rely on?

It’s okay, walls, tree trunks, sculptures, all can provide it with a place to cling on!

Roses can freely put out different sized buds, and holly can freely stretch as per its ambition.

Every plant in the garden could follow its own talent.

Isn’t this the ultimate fairness for the plants?”

Blue Bird gently patted Lin Guo’s head signalling him to calm down.

Xiao Xiao moved his lips but did not continue to argue.

“Sounds like they’re on par.” Zheng Qing rubbed his nose and murmured.

“So both Jiuyou Academy and Alpha Academy still coexist inside the First University.” Zhang Ji Xin crossed his arms and concluded, “But no matter which garden it is, the owner wants to see a beautiful garden—this conclusion can only be determined by time.”

The newcomers, who had come to accept their punishment, fell into long silence.

A cold wind blew.

Zheng Qing tightened his sleeves and looked up.

The sky was already turning grey.

Faint, the sun had completely disappeared from view.

The dim, massive, grey patches looked like ugly patches, applied to the horizon, revealing hints of dampness and inertia.

The black administrative building of the school was still standing silently in front of them, with no changes at all.

Zheng Qing once again pulled out that pale red notice.

“Maybe there’s a map or spell hidden on the paper?” He held the notice with his law book, trying to find some clues.

Zhang Ji Xin was also interested in pulling out his law book, tapping his notice with the spine of the book.

“Will we be late?

If we’re late, will the punishment be increased?” Lin Guo reverted back to his timid little boy state.

“Someone’s there.” Blue Bird’s cold voice sounded in everyone’s ears.

Following his gaze, Zheng Qing saw a skinny old man sitting under a willow tree not far away.

“Let’s go and ask!” Zhang Ji Xin put away his law book and notice, and ran eagerly towards the tree.

The rest of them looked at each other, and followed him towards the old man.
